Rosie Maguire

Associate Contact via: Rosie Maguire was previously a senior consultant for NEF Consulting. Rosie has extensive experience in providing clients, including local authorities, NHS organisations, national and local charities with bespoke outcome measurement frameworks and evaluations of their work. Rosemary is… Read more »

Michael Weatherhead

International Director E: Michael Weatherhead is the International (and former Managing) Director of NEF Consulting. He is currently based in Spain, developing new opportunities within Europe. Previously Michael established a new branch in South Africa in September 2012 to take NEF’s ideas… Read more »


HEAD OF MARKETING T: + 44 (0) 207 820 6352 E: Mary-Lou joined NEF Consulting in 2013. She is responsible for development and implementation of the marketing strategy and for overall management of training projects and programmes. Before joining NEF Consulting,… Read more »

Graham Randles

Managing Director T: + 44 (0) 207 820 6374 E: Graham Randles is NEF Consulting’s Managing Director. Since joining in June 2012, Graham has spearheaded a strategic drive to apply market-leading methodologies for social impact assessment based on the… Read more »

Alison Freeman

Senior Consultant T: + 44 (0) 207 820 6393 E: Alison has a strong background in triple bottom line and sustainable value measurement, and likes to work on projects where environmental, wellbeing and community factors need embedding into decision… Read more »

Happiness works in the Chinese apparel industry

Authors: Michael Weatherhead and Jody Aked. People in work are the same the world over. In efforts to improve happiness and wellbeing, it seems there is more to connect us than separate us. We recently took the ideas and tools of NEF and Happiness… Read more »